
Victorian, circa 1870. 4.7ins high, 10.2ins wide, 5.5ins depth. Minton Majolica candlestick holder which features a robin perched on a twig, with leaves and floral decoration.
Colouration: green, white, dark pink, are predominant.
The piece bears maker's marks for the Minton pottery. Bears a pattern number, '1567'. English diamond registration mark for the date 02/03/1870. Marks include a factory specific date cipher for the year 1870.
CONDITION: Good. Two tiny flakes to petals of pink flower.
RESTORATION. Remodelled beak.
Filled chip to tip of robin's right wing and rim of dish.
Retouched flakes to rim of candle holder.
